Careers at Rooster Technology

Businesses always say that “People” are their greatest asset. Rooster is for the businesses that actually back up that claim by bringing balance and transparency to recruiting.

Visit Website

Finance

Full-timeColombo, Sri Lanka

Administrations

Full-timeColombo, Sri Lanka